Oliver DelGado was born and raised in Los Angeles, California. He attended the University of Wisconsin-Madison on a merit scholarship, where he studied journalism and mass communication. He currently serves as the Director of Communication & Marketing for Para Los Niños.
Oliver’s background spans an array of impressive communications industries including corporate entertainment, city government and non-profit. Prior to joining Para Los Niños, he served as L.A. Mayor Eric Garcetti’s sole bilingual communications specialist– focusing on the city’s global brand and leading innovative campaigns boosting municipal services (Metro, LADWP, etc.) and homeland security policies.
Prior to his close work with Mayor Garcetti, Oliver held external relations roles with then Councilmember Garcetti’s Council District 13 office and the Partnership for Los Angeles Schools– Mayor Antonio Villaraigosa’s cornerstone initiative aimed at improving public education on the east and south sides of the city. In 2016, Mayor Garcetti appointed Oliver to the Central Area Planning Commission, a board overseeing the city’s planning, land-use and real estate development.
